Dhurandhar: The Revenge – Paid Previews Advance Booking Crosses 2.17 Lakh Tickets in National Chains

Dhurandhar: The Revenge – Paid Previews Advance Booking Crosses 2.17 Lakh Tickets in National Chains

The advance booking storm for Dhurandhar: The Revenge is getting bigger with every passing hour. The Ranveer Singh starrer continues its phenomenal rampage at the box office even before release, smashing past another massive milestone in paid previews.

As per the latest updates till 11:00 PM, the film has now crossed the 2.17 lakh ticket mark in national multiplex chains, taking its total paid preview advance sales to 2,17,540 tickets across PVR INOX and Cinepolis. The explosive surge reflects the extraordinary buzz surrounding the high-octane action spectacle.

Metro Cities Driving the Momentum

Major metropolitan markets continue to dominate the advance booking charts. Mumbai and Delhi-NCR remain the biggest contributors, witnessing relentless demand for preview shows across multiplexes with several fast-filling shows.

Strong Push from Southern Markets

The response from southern markets has also been exceptional. Bengaluru, Chennai and Hyderabad are adding tremendous momentum to the advance booking numbers, highlighting the film’s growing pan-India appeal and expanding audience curiosity.

Paid Previews Alone Creating History

What makes this milestone even more remarkable is that the film has achieved this feat purely through paid preview bookings. Ticket sales have been accelerating rapidly throughout the day across urban centres, with multiplex chains witnessing blistering booking speed.

With over 2,17,540 tickets already sold for paid previews, Dhurandhar: The Revenge is now firmly on track to deliver one of the biggest preview openings in Indian cinema history, putting several long-standing records under serious threat.
